Nucleic Acid Metabolism
The set of biochemical processes responsible for the synthesis, degradation, and regulation of nucleic acids (DNA and RNA) in living organisms.
Gout
Condition caused by the inability of the urinary system to remove uric acid from the body.
Creatinine
A waste product generated from muscle metabolism and discharged into the urine, often used to assess kidney function.
Renal Failure
A medical condition where the kidneys lose the ability to remove waste and balance fluids in the body.
